7 Hard drive retention screw Secures the hard drive bay cover to
the tablet PC.
8 Hard drive bay Holds the system hard drive.
9 Hard drive security screws (2) Secure the hard drive in the hard
drive bay.
10 Pad feet (2) Stabilize the tablet PC when it is
placed as a free-standing tablet on
a flat surface.
11 Battery bay Holds the battery pack.
12 Battery retention screw Secures the battery pack to the
tablet PC.
13 Battery quick check lights (3) On: Each light represents a
percentage of a full charge. For
example, when all three lights are
on, the battery pack is fully
charged.
Flashing: When one light is
flashing, less than 10% of a full
charge remains in the battery pack.
14 Battery quick check button Activates the battery quick check
lights, which display how much
of a full charge remains in the
battery pack.
15 Battery pack release latch Releases the battery pack from the
battery bay.
